We are currently seeking a construction laborer to join our team. As a construction laborer, you will work alongside experienced carpenters and construction professionals to assist in the construction, repair, and maintenance of decks and outdoor structures. The ideal candidate is physically fit, possesses a strong work ethic, and has a willingness to learn and grow in the field of deck construction. This is a hands-on role that requires attention to detail, the ability to follow instructions, and a commitment to safety and quality.
Responsibilities:
- Assist in the preparation for construction of decks and outdoor structures.
- Carry and transport construction materials, tools, and equipment to and from the work site.
- Prepare work areas by removing existing structures, clearing debris, and setting up necessary equipment.
- Assist in the installation of concrete piers, gravel, and other materials.
- Measure and cut materials according to specifications, ensuring accuracy and proper fit.
- Operate hand and power tools safely and effectively, following instructions and guidelines.
- Clean and maintain tools and equipment, ensuring they are in good working condition.
- Assist in the preparation of work surfaces, including sanding, staining, and sealing.
- Follow safety protocols and guidelines to minimize risks and maintain a safe working environment.
- Collaborate with the construction team to complete projects within specified timeframes.
- Communicate effectively with supervisors and coworkers, reporting any issues or concerns.
